Robert F. Kennedy Jr., the US Secretary of Health, has gone viral on social media after a video showed him catching a pair of snakes barehanded while they were tangled together.

Wildlife experts have cautioned the public against attempting such actions.

In the video, Kennedy shares details of removing ‘black racer’ snakes from the home of his friend, Dr. Mehmet Oz, located on the coast of Florida.

A woman repeatedly asks Kennedy to release the snakes during the video; she is Kennedy’s wife and actress Cheryl Hines.

According to the US National Park Service, ‘black racer’ snakes are non-venomous and do not harm humans unless threatened.
